Shopping

In Ironbridge, visit Maws Craft Centre, just 1.6km away, for unique gifts and local crafts. Telford Shopping Centre, located 6.4km from Ironbridge, features a mix of shops, family entertainment, and eateries. If you're up for a drive, Ludlow Food Centre is 32.2km away, offering delightful local produce.

  • Iron Bridge: Step into history at the iconic Iron Bridge, the first cast-iron bridge in the world. Immerse yourself in its rich cultural significance and enjoy picturesque views of the River Severn, making it a perfect spot for photos and reflection.
  • The International Centre: Located 4.8km from Ironbridge, this modern event and conference venue is ideal for those attending business functions or exhibitions. Its contemporary design and professional atmosphere make it a key hub for various events.
  • Blists Hill: Just 1.6km from Ironbridge, this living museum transports you back to the Victorian era. Explore historic buildings, meet costumed characters, and experience traditional crafts, offering a unique glimpse into life in the 1800s.

Best time to go to Ironbridge

The best time to visit Ironbridge can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Ironbridge fal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Ironbridge fal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January38.8°F (3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February40.1°F (4.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
March42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.6°F (8.1°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May52.2°F (11.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June57.7°F (14.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August60.3°F (15.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September56.5°F (13.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October51.3°F (10.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November44.8°F (7.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
